Understanding Bonus Codes: More Than Just Free Money
At the heart of many online casino promotions are bonus codes—strings of letters and numbers that unlock perks such as free spins, deposit matches, or no-deposit bonuses. But how do these bonuses really work, and how are they best used?
From my experience working with Southeast Asian gaming platforms, bonus codes are designed primarily as marketing tools to attract and retain customers. However, savvy players recognize that unlocking the full value of these bonuses requires careful attention to terms and conditions, such as wagering requirements or game restrictions.
For example, an Indonesian operator recently launched a “gotong royong” themed bonus to engage community-driven gameplay—a nod to Indonesian culture’s spirit of communal cooperation. This bonus required players to place bets within a week to unlock escalating jackpot opportunities, illustrating how bonus codes can be linked to broader user engagement strategies.
Vietnamese players accessing international platforms commonly encounter welcome bonuses promising “100% deposit match up to VND 5 million.” These can double initial capital but often come with 20x wagering requirements. Ignoring these details can lead to frustration or even loss of funds despite the allure of “bonus” money.

Legal and Ethical Considerations for Vietnamese Players
Vietnam’s legal stance on gambling is complex. While traditional casinos such as the Crown International Club in Phu Quoc Province have government licenses, online gambling remains mostly restricted with some pilot exceptions. A cautious regulatory stance stems from concerns about social harm, economic impact, and money laundering risks.
For Vietnamese players, this legal ambiguity creates challenges. Many resort to offshore online casinos, which may not have safeguards or fair-play certifications. This situation underscores the importance of verifying the legitimacy of platforms and understanding the fine print behind bonus codes.
